site stats

Gorm references

WebGorm is: Practical as well as theoretical oriented; Analytic as well as resolute/ action-oriented; Tecnical- as well as people minded; Strategic- … WebApr 6, 2024 · Override References. GORM usually uses the owner’s primary key as the foreign key’s value, for the above example, it is the User‘s ID, When you assign credit cards to a user, GORM will save the user’s ID into credit cards’ UserID field. You … Override Foreign Key. For a has one relationship, a foreign key field must … references: Specifies column name of the reference’s table that is mapped to the … PreloadGORM allows eager loading relations in other SQL with Preload, for … Eager Loading. GORM allows eager loading has many associations with …

Using dynamic struct of slices (which contains foreign keys) …

WebJun 4, 2024 · When gorm performs a callback to save Associations, which has a separate block for handling slices, the runtime type identified was not slices (It was pointer). So it assumed it to be struct and went ahead processing it as a simple struct. WebApr 11, 2024 · GORM prefers convention over configuration. By default, GORM uses ID as primary key, pluralizes struct name to snake_cases as table name, snake_case as column name, and uses CreatedAt, UpdatedAt to track creating/updating time If you follow the conventions adopted by GORM, you’ll need to write very little configuration/code. top ten pc games in 2022 https://mobecorporation.com

How to delete a table with relationships in GORM?

WebDefine gorm. gorm synonyms, gorm pronunciation, gorm translation, English dictionary definition of gorm. n. Upper Southern US Variant of gaum. ... All content on this website, … WebApr 20, 2024 · Having the same issue. embedded tag is not a workaround for this, you can not aggregate multiple separate tables into a single one and call it a solution, this will come with a lot of drawbacks and is not how relational databases are desired to be used.. Preload is also no viable option considering it's performance difference especially for large data … WebAug 19, 2024 · first, you must get Gorm v2 and MySQL dialector by run this commands on your terminal. go get -u gorm.io/gorm // get gorm v2 go get -u gorm.io/driver/mysql // get dialector of mysql from gorm then you can use Clauses … top ten pc survival games

gorm package - gorm.io/gorm - Go Packages

Category:Belongs to foreign key field name cannot be equal to primary key …

Tags:Gorm references

Gorm references

database - Gorm Associations Many to Many - Stack Overflow

WebApr 11, 2024 · GORM 2.0 is a rewrite from scratch, it introduces some incompatible-API change and many improvements Highlights Performance Improvements Modularity Context, Batch Insert, Prepared Statement Mode, Dry ... Full self-reference relationships support, Join Table improvements, Association Mode for batch data; Multiple fields allowed to … WebApr 14, 2024 · 100milsats assigned jinzhu on Apr 14, 2024 github-actions bot added the type:with reproduction steps label a631807682 mentioned this issue on Jun 30, 2024 doc (belongs_to): add references special scenarios go-gorm/gorm.io#550 jinzhu closed this as completed in go-gorm/gorm.io#550 on Jul 1, 2024

Gorm references

Did you know?

WebOct 14, 2024 · When I'm creating a user with languages I don't need to do insertion into languages but I want to create a reference in a joint table only. In gorm v1 such behaviour was achieved by using association_autoupdate:false tag in a model. In gorm v2 method Omit("Languages") also omits reference. Thank you! WebDec 1, 2024 · The gorm struct tags are not required as the foreign key constraints are created by Gorm by simply referencing Owner as type Owner – barjo Dec 1, 2024 at 23:52 1 Yes, you're right, you don't need to define a tag, you use a simple linkage. My fault. – outdead Dec 2, 2024 at 0:04 Add a comment 0

WebJan 28, 2024 · The CreatedAt field has tag gorm:”autoCreateTime:milli” and has type int64, this means that GORM will auto-fill this field with a Unix timestamp having millisecond … WebMar 18, 2024 · gorm (third-person singular simple present gorms, present participle gorming, simple past and past participle gormed) (UK and US, dialects) To gawk; to stare or gape. ... References . Maine lingo: boiled owls, billdads & wazzats (1975), page 114: "A man who bungles a job has gormed it. Anybody who stumbles over his own feet is gormy."

WebAug 28, 2024 ·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ams WebNov 24, 2024 · What is the approach in Go Gorm for writing and updating records that are back-referencing many to many structs. For example, I have a Contact struct with a self …

Web43 minutes ago · What's I think is that I rely on gorm strongly, that's may be bad. Do I need to define a trancation interface for only unit test? unit-testing; go; go-gorm; go-testing; Share. Follow ... back them up with references or personal experience. To learn more, see our tips on writing great answers. Sign up or log in. Sign up using Google ...

WebAug 14, 2024 · Since GORM automatically pluralizes and converts tables to snake_case, I reference the column people (id). If you overwrite this functionality, use whatever table and column name you have. Share Follow answered Apr 23, 2024 at 17:49 robbieperry22 1,803 1 16 47 Add a comment Your Answer top ten pediatric physical therapyhttp://v1.gorm.io/docs/associations.html top ten pc tuneup softwareWebJan 9, 2024 · I think you select the wrong column on your subquery DB.Select ("user_id") should be DB.Select ("uuid") right? ( gorm: "references:UUID") – David Yappeter Jan 9, 2024 at 15:38 @DavidYappeter no the subquery works fine. The field on the profiles table is called user_id and it references the field uuid of the user. – zarathustra Jan 9, 2024 at … top ten pdf reader for windowsWebApr 11, 2024 · GORM The fantastic ORM library for Golang, aims to be developer friendly. Overview Full-Featured ORM Associations (Has One, Has Many, Belongs To, Many To … top ten pcp air riflesWebSep 30, 2024 · G-ORM – Golang ORM Package. Currently sitting at 21000 stars (!!!) on Github, gorm is a package developed mostly by Jingzhu, with a few commits from other interested individuals. It is a full-featured ORM and has several features that help us as Go devs. Object Relationship Managers act as brokers between us developers and our … top ten pdf editorWebOct 19, 2024 · Like this: import "gorm.io/gorm" type Model struct { gorm.Model Code string `bson:"code" json:" Stack Overflow. About; Products For Teams; Stack Overflow Public questions & answers; Stack Overflow for Teams Where ... GORM: Reference to same table. Ask Question Asked 1 year, 5 months ago. Modified 1 year, 5 months ago. Viewed … top ten people with extra body partsWebApr 11, 2024 · type Config struct { // GORM perform single create, update, delete operations in transactions by default to ensure database data integrity // You can disable it by setting `SkipDefaultTransaction` to true SkipDefaultTransaction bool // NamingStrategy tables, columns naming strategy NamingStrategy schema. top ten percent income uk